パワートレース(PowerTrace)


The embedded tools company


Picture
  ハイライト
軽快なデバッガかつ高速ダウンロード
オンチップ及び外部フラッシュフラッシュプログラミングをサポート
ハードウェアブレークポイントとトリガー機能 (チップの仕様による)
プログラム及びデータフローのトレース
16 Mフレームトレース
統計機能
パフォーマンス解析
コードカバレッジ
USB、イーサネット又はパラレルインタフェース
 
  はじめに
TRACE32-PowerTrace は、1つの筐体に高速デバッグ機能と16Mフレームトレースメモリ を搭載したものです。本ツールでは、オンチップデバッグ規格に加えて NEXUS や ARM-ETM のような全ての共通トレースポートをもサポートしています。


Doc
ドキュメント
powertrace.pdf
(1430k)
Freq
動作周波数
Order
オーダー情報
Support
テクニカルサポート



TOP

PowerTrace Concept




PowerTraceモジュールには、トレース及びデバッグのための全てのシステムが組み込まれています。本システムは200MHzで動作するMPU PowerPCがコントローラとして搭載されており、高速なダウンロード及びトレースのアップロードを実現しています。

TOP

Controller


CPU

  • 200 MHz PowerPC
  • 250 Drystone 2.1 MIPS
  • 64 MByte SDRAM

PODBUS インタフェース(PC), TRACE32-ICE 及び TRACE32-FIRE

ダイレクトUSBインタフェース Direct USB Interface

12 MBit/sec

ダイレクトファーストイーサネットインタフェース Direct FastEthernet Interface

10/100 MBit/sec
TOP

Active Debugger


現在リリース中のデバッガ

対応デバッグインタフェース

  • BDM
  • JTAG
  • OCDS
  • ONCE

インサーキットエミュレータとのソフトウェア互換性

  • Operation System
  • PRACTICE
  • ASM Debugger
  • HLL Debugger for C,C++, ADA, PASCAL
  • Peripheral Windows

高速ダウンロード High-Speed Download

  • Up to 5000 KByte/sec
  • Fastest JTAG Debugger worldwide


      ProcessorkByte/secJTAG Clock Speed
      PowerPC (PQ3)520050 MHz
      NIOS-II (Altera)200040 MHz
      Tricore125025 MHz
      ARM940125030 MHz
      MPC860170040 MHz
      SH482020 MHz

可変デバッグクロックスピード

  • 10 kHz...5 MHz
  • 1/4 CPU Clock
  • 1/8 CPU Clock
  • Variable up to 100 MHz
TOP

Trace Analyzer


トレースポート Trace Port

  • 最大 92 トレースチャンネル (100 MHz)
  • 最大 46 トレースチャンネル (200 MHz)

サポートされているアダプタ Supported Adapters



MICTOR アダプタ接続 Mictor Adaption

  • 2個のMictorプローブ (34チャンネル) をご利用になれます。

トレースストレージ Trace Strage

  • 256/512 MByte トレースストレージ
  • 16 Mフレーム
  • Full Dual-ported
  • ハードウェアサーチエンジン
  • 640 MByte/sec サンプリング周波数
  • タイムスタンプ 12.5 (20) ns 分解能
  • TRACE32ツールを使った時間相関性とトラッキング

コードカバレッジ Code Coverage

  • ハードウェアコードカバレッジ
  • 4 Segments with 2 or 4 MByte each

データカバレッジ Data Coverage

  • ハードウェアデータカバレッジ
  • 4 Segments with 256 or 512 KByte each

シャドーメモリ Shadow Memory

  • 4 Segments with 256 or 512 KByte each

ブレークポイント Breakpoints

  • 4つのブレークポイントメモリ(256又は512 KBit)

トリガーシーケンサ Trigger Sequencer

  • 4 トリガイベント
  • 4 トリガイベント
  • 3 トリガカウンタ

トリガディレー Trigger Delay

  • 0 .. 300 s

外部トリガ External Trigger

  • PODBUSから入力
  • PODBUSに出力

パフォーマンスアナライザ Performance Analyzer

EPROM/FLASH Simulator のサポート

  • ROMエリアにブレークポイントを設定可
  • 16と32ビットEPROM/FLASHエミュレーション
TOP

Software Debugger


ASM デバッガ
  • 各種ファイルフォーマットのサポート
  • 軽快な操作性
  • アセンブラソースレベルのデバッグ
  • 高機能メモリ表示
  • インラインアセンブラ
  • メモリ試験
  • ウインドウのカスタマイズ
  • ペリフェラルウインドウ
  • ターミナルウインドウ
  • 簡易ホスティング機能
  • Flash プログラミング
  • ペリフェラルをフルサポート
HLL デバッガ
  • 各種言語サポート
  • C++ フルサポート
  • TRACE32 環境への組込み
  • 各種コンパイラとホストのサポート
  • 異なるホスト間で統一された操作性
  • 高速ダウンロード
  • 最適化されたコードのデバッグ
  • 関数ネスティングの表示
  • リンクリストの表示
  • 軽快な操作性
  • 強力な式評価
メモリ解析
  • 割り当てられたメモリブロックの表示
  • メモリアロケーション統計機能
  • 領域外書き込みのチェック
  • 割り当て関数コールのトレース機能
  • メモリ使用状況の画像表示
インテリジェント・ローダ
  • ダウンロードスピードが最大30倍までアップ
  • MPC8260、MPC8560、MPC755にて利用可
  • 低周波数動作デバイスのダウンロードスピードをアップ
  • シリアルROMモニタ使用時のロードスピードをアップ
マルチコアデバッグ
  • 同種または異種のマルチプロセッサ/マルチコアの組み込みアプリケーションデバッグ
  • 高品質の標準デバッガをマルチプロセッサ/マルチコアのデバッグに利用可
  • 全てのTRACE32-ICD デバッガはマルチプロセッサ/マルチコアのデバッグ環境で同時利用可
  • サードパーティーのデバッガへのすばやい対応
  • 単一シリコン上の各プロセッサが同一のデバッグポートをシェア可能
  • スタート/ストップの同期
Full MMU Support
  • プロセッサのもつMMU機能を統合的にサポート
  • プロセッサのもつMMUレジスタの表示
  • MMUテーブルエントリ表示
  • アドレス変換テーブル表示
  • 「シャドーイング」(デバッガ内のMMUアドレス変換)
  • ターゲットへ仮想/物理アクセス
  • 保護メモリ領域への書き込み機能(オプション)
  • OSによるソフトウェアMMUテーブルの認識とデコード
  • ユーザスペースMMUテーブル
  • TLBコンテクストトラッキング
ペリフェラルブラウザ
  • チップ上のペリフェラルの表示
  • ユーザー定義型ウィンドウ
  • ソフトキーも使えるインタラクティブウィンドウ定義
  • 候補選択時のプルダウンメニュー
  • 各フィールドに解説の追加
PRACTICE スクリプト言語
  • 構造化言語
  • メニューのサポート
  • コマンドのログ
  • カスタムメニュー
  • ツールバーやボタンのカスタム化
  • ダイアログウインドウのカスタム化
  • 64ビット算術演算
  • 数字、論理、文字列操作
  • システム状態への直接アクセス
FLASH プログラミング
  • 内部/外部 FLASHメモリに対応
  • 全ての一般的なFLASHメモリ仕様に準拠
  • 複数のFLASHデバイスプログラミングをサポート
  • ICE, FIRE, ICD 製品ラインで利用可能
NAND FLASHプログラミング
  • CPU共通およびCPU専用 NAND FLASHコントローラに対応
  • 全ての一般的なNAND FLASHデバイスに対応
  • バッドブロック処理 (skipped, reserved block area)
  • ECC 生成
SIM インストラクションセットシミュレータ
  • 扱い易い高級言語及びアセンブラデバッガ
  • 多くのコンパイラに対応
  • トレースバッファ
  • 強力なスクリプト言語
  • 全てのTRACE32 toolsにソフトウェア互換
  • ハードウェアシミュレーション機能
Statistic Analyzer
  • 関数の実行時間を詳細解析
  • タスク実行時間/ステートを詳細解析
  • 変数の変化の推移を時間軸でグラフィカル解析
  • 単一イベントのタイムインターバルを解析 (割込み処理など)
  • 2つのイベント間のタイムインターバルを解析
トレースベースコードカバレッジ
  • ETM ハードウェアカバレッジ解析
  • トレースベースカバレッジ解析
  • アセンブラ、高級言語、及び関数レベル解析
パフォーマンスアナライザ
  • 関数レベルでの長時間パフォーマンス解析
  • タスクレベルでの長時間パフォーマンス解析
  • 変数やメモリ内の値を長時間にわたり計測、解析
スマートトレース, トレース解析のためのインテリジェントソフトウェア
  • 失われたコード情報の穴埋め
  • 直接分岐の再構築
  • CTSを使って間接分岐の再構築
  • CTSである時点でのメモリおよびレジスタの値を検証
エナジープロファイリング
  • 3電流, 4電圧をリアルタイム計測
  • 電流, 電圧および電力イベントによるリアルタイムトリガ
  • TRACE32トレースツールとの時間相関
  • 関数およびタスクレベルで消費電力の統計解析
  • TRACE32ユーザインタフェースに統合化
CTSコンテキストトラッキングシステム
  • リアルタイムプログラムのシングルステップ
  • ローカルおよびグローバル変数の表示
  • スタックフレーム表示
  • ステップ、バックステップとステップオーバー
  • 条件付ステップ
  • トレース上でのレジスタ変数の表示
  • トレース上でのパラメータ付関数ネスティング表示
ロガー
  • ターゲット上で並列構造状に蓄積された全てのサイズのソフトウェアトレース
  • TRACE32-PowerViewの一般的なトレース形式
  • TRACE32-PowerViewの構成及び表示コマンド
  • アドレス及びデータ情報を持つトレースとして動作
  • プログラムフロートレースとして動作(SH4, PowerPC)
  • タイムスタンプ利用可
  • 弊社製のトレースを満たす定義済みアルゴリズム
  • トレースを満たすユーザー定義アルゴリズム
FDX (Fast Data eXchange) フレームワーク
  • ホスト上のサードパーティアプリケーションとターゲットアプリケーションのインタラクション
  • ハードウェアの追加不要
  • 高大域幅
  • リアルタイムデータ転送
  • ソフトウェアトレース機能
スヌーパー
  • アプリケーションを実行しながらメモリを採取
  • 特別デバッグコミュニケーションチャンネルをサポート
  • 全てのトレース表示及び解析機能を使用可能
  • 特定の値でトリガー実行
  • 動的なパフォーマンス解析
RTOS デバッガ
  • タスク実行時間の統計的な評価及びグラフィック表示
  • タスクに関連の・る関数実行時間評価
  • タスク状態の統計的な評価及びグラフィック表示
  • システムコールの手動実行
  • タスクスタックカバレッジ
  • OSデータ用のPRACTICE関数
  • RTOS に関連の・るプルダウンメニュー
  • タスクを選択デバッグ
サードパーティツールの統合
  • エディタの統合
  • CASE ツールの統合
  • カーネルの統合
ヘルプシステム
  • •Acrobatをベースとしたドキュメント
  • •高速テキスト検索
  • •デバイス専用フィルタ機能
  • •基本的及び高度なヘルプ機能
  • •トレーニングマニュアル
  • •WWW アップデート
TOP

Supported Processor Lines



Supported CPUs by Debugger

Supported CPUs by Trace

Other WWW Sites

TOP

Extensions


フレックスアダプタ
  • 非常にフレキシブルアダプタ
  • 高信号品質
  • 合インピーダンス
  • MICTOR
  • 100 MIL
  • SAMTEC
  • YAMAICHI
ハーフサイズアダプタ
  • 100 mil ⇒ 50 mil サイズ変換アダプタ
  • ターゲット上コネクタの設置面積を縮小化
Logic and Protocol Analyzer (PowerProbe)
  • 最大400MHzのタイミングアナライザ
  • 最大100MHzのステートアナライザ
  • 64入力チャンネル
  • 一時記録機能
  • 時間相関の・るRISCトレース
  • ステートクロック用クロック選定機能
  • ステート及びタイミング混在モード
  • 4個のステートクロック入力
  • SOCターゲット用アダプタ
  • オプションのパターンジェネレータ
  • CAN, USBなどのプロトコルサポート
Bus Analyzer (PowerIntegrator)
  • 全チャンネルで500MHzのタイミングアナライザ
  • 最大250MHzのステートアナライザ
  • 204入力チャンネル
  • トランジェントレコーディング
  • 時間相関のあるRISCトレース
  • ステートクロック用クロック選定機能
  • 混合ステートとタイミングモード
  • 4クロック入力
  • MICTOR型プローブと標準プローブ
  • MICTOR ディファレンシャルプローブ
  • アナログ電圧/電流プローブ
  • 3G/DigRF プロトコルアナライザ
EPROM/FLASH Simulator
  • 8, 16, 32 Bit 動作
  • 2, 8, 16, 64 MBit バージョン
  • DIL 又は PLCC アダプタ
  • SO アダプタ
  • TSOP アダプタ
  • インサーキットシミュレーション用ESI-CON
  • モニタ制御
  • NMI及びRESET信号生成
Trigger Probe
  • ICE, FIRE 及び ICDと共に使用
  • 非同期トリガー機能
  • 同期トリガー機能
  • パルス幅トリガー機能
  • 異常発生トリガー
  • スコープトリガー出力

TOP

Configuration Examples


TOP

Debugger, Trace and EPROM/FLASH Simulator on PC or Workstation


Hub 10-Base-T or 100-Base-T
PowerTrace Module
EPROM/FLASH Simulator Module
 
TOP

Debugger and Trace on PC with USB Interface


 
USB2
PowerTrace Module
with USB Interface
 
TOP

Debugger and Trace on PC with USB Interface


 
USB2
PowerTrace Module
with USB Interface
Mixed Operation JTAG/Trace
 
TOP

Debugger, Trace and EPROM/FLASH Simulator on PC with USB Interface


 
USB2
PowerTrace Module
with USB Interface
EPROM/FLASH Simulator Module
 
TOP

PowerTrace and Timing/State Analyzer on PC or Workstation


Hub 10-Base-T or 100-Base-T
PowerTrace Module
Extension Cable
State/Timing Analyzer
 
TOP

PowerTrace and Timing/State Analyzer on PC or Workstation


Hub 10-Base-T or 100-Base-T
PowerTrace Module
Timing Analyzer SOC (ASIC/FPGA)
 
TOP

PowerTrace with MICTOR probes on PC or Workstation


Hub 10-Base-T or 100-Base-T
PowerTrace Module
Mictor Probes
 






Copyright © 2012 Lauterbach Japan, Ltd., Kouhoku-ku, Yokohama-shi, Japan 222-0033  Impressum
The information presented is intended to give overview information only.
Changes and technical enhancements or modifications can be made without notice.
Last generated/modified: 1-Feb-2012